Summary/Abstract: Purpose of the article is to identify the role of choreography for athletes of the technical-aesthetic kinds of sport. Methodology. The methodology is based on the methods: general-historical, comparative, analytical. Scientific novelty. The research for the first time considered the role of choreographic training in the training of athletes of the technical-aesthetic kinds of sport from the position of the art studies. Conclusions. The newest trend in art studies is the interaction of art (choreography, music, clothing design, etc.) and technical-aesthetic kinds of sport. The functions of choreographic training in the process of pursuing technical-aesthetic kinds of sport include as a purely applied (recreational, educational, training, etc.), and artistic and aesthetic (decorative, imaginative, spectacular, etc.). This combination helps in solving problems related to physical activity in different muscle groups, as well as the development of the rhythm and musicality necessary to create an aesthetically pleasing performance. The substantial content of the dance training in the technical-aesthetic kinds of sport is to capture a wide variety of varieties, trends, choreography styles (exercise of classical dance, elements of folk-stage, ballroom, modern dance), which contributes to the expansion of the physical and artistic range of athletes.
